Meet Faye. She has a good salary, her own home and a paralysing fear of intimacy. Occasionally, she hauls her laptop to her local bar to run the daily gauntlet of rejection from her workday. One day, she buys a diary. During one of her usual one-night stands, an unexpected revelation triggers her buried past and forces Faye to take stock of her solitary life... By award-winning writer of BBC's Rab C Nesbitt, Ian Pattison. 'Gail Watson is a Tour De Force as Faye' (Scotsman).
